HTML5和CSS3是当今网页设计和制作中非常重要的两个技术,HTML5是一种用于创建网页的标准标记语言,它允许开发者使用更简洁、更高效的代码来构建网站,而CSS3则是一种样式表语言,它可以为网页添加丰富的视觉效果,使得网页更加美观和易于阅读。
在HTML5中,我们可以使用各种标签来定义网页的结构,例如<header>
、<nav>
、<main>
、<section>
等,这些标签可以帮助我们组织页面的内容,并为其分配合适的样式,HTML5还引入了一些新的元素,如<video>
、<audio>
和<canvas>
,这些元素使得我们可以在网页中嵌入视频、音频和画布等内容。
CSS3则提供了更多的选择器和属性,使得我们可以轻松地为网页元素添加各种样式,我们可以使用background-color
属性来设置元素的背景颜色,使用width
和height
属性来调整元素的大小,使用border
属性来设置元素的边框等,CSS3还支持Flexbox布局、Grid布局和动画等功能,这些功能可以帮助我们更加灵活地设计网页。
在实际的网页设计和制作过程中,我们需要将HTML5和CSS3结合起来,以实现一个既美观又实用的网站,我们需要使用HTML5编写网页的结构,然后使用CSS3为网页元素添加样式,在这个过程中,我们可能需要使用一些预处理器(如Sass或Less),它们可以帮助我们编写更简洁、更易于维护的CSS代码。
下面是一个简单的HTML5和CSS3网页设计与制作的示例:
<!DOCTYPE html> <html lang="zh"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>我的网站</title> <style> body { font-family: Arial, sans-serif; margin: 0; padding: 0; } header { background-color: #f1f1f1; padding: 20px; text-align: center; } nav { display: flex; justify-content: space-around; background-color: #333; } nav a { color: white; text-decoration: none; padding: 14px 20px; } nav a:hover { background-color: #ddd; color: black; } main { padding: 20px; } footer { background-color: #f1f1f1; padding: 20px; text-align: center; } </style> </head> <body> <header> <h1>欢迎来到我的网站</h1> </header> <nav> <a href="#">首页</a> <a href="#">关于我们</a> <a href="#">联系我们</a> </nav> <main> <h2>网站介绍</h2> <p>这是一个使用HTML5和CSS3制作的简单网站示例。在这里,我们可以看到如何使用HTML5定义网页结构,以及如何使用CSS3为网页元素添加样式。</p> </main> <footer> 版权所有 © 我的网站公司 </footer> </body> </html>
相关问题与解答:
1、如何使用HTML5和CSS3创建响应式网站?请简要介绍一下方法。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/98507.html